You were nevertheless right: I found out that dragging the mouse to mark
something sets transient-mark-mode to 'identity behind my back. Even with
emacs -q.
This is a feature. When the user drags a region, it is highlighted
for the next command, and various commands will operate on that region.
Could you explain why this strikes you as a bug? What is the precise
sequence of inputs that you use, and what behavior do you see?
